Another Cryptocurrency Initiative Closes This Week Following $8.4 Million Theft
Bunni's Rapid Growth and Subsequent Exploit: Bunni, a promising DeFi liquidity protocol, saw its total value locked surge from over $2 million to nearly $80 million in just two months before a security exploit on September 2 drained millions in tokens, leading to the protocol's immediate halt.
Shutdown Announcement and Financial Struggles: Over six weeks later, the Bunni team announced the shutdown of the protocol, citing the high costs of necessary audits and security measures as financially unfeasible, with most of their capital already depleted.
Open-Sourcing of Code and User Withdrawals: In a bid to contribute to the developer community, Bunni re-licensed its v2 smart contracts under the MIT open-source license, allowing others to build on its innovations, while also enabling users to withdraw their locked assets.
Broader Implications for the Crypto Industry: Bunni's downfall reflects a troubling trend in the crypto space, where mid-sized projects struggle under market pressures and security vulnerabilities, highlighting the need for financial resilience and robust security measures in decentralized finance.
